Chapter 31 Martial Arts Prodigy(2/2)

"You must be very knowledgeable about fighting, right?"

"Tomorrow happens to be the day when I participate in the Tokyo Karate Competition. At that time, young masters from all over Tokyo will be present."

"If Mr. Lin is interested, you can come with us to have a look."

As she spoke, Xiaolan added modestly:

"With my current ability, I may not be able to place well in the Tokyo Karate Competition."

"This...is like this."

Lin Xinyi stopped talking:

It turns out superhumans like you can still appear together!

And this is just a "karate" competition within the "Tokyo metropolitan area"...

Then if we add up all the masters of fighting styles in the world, and do some calculations, wouldn’t there be little supermen everywhere on this earth who can kick down walls with one kick?

Lin Xinyi was considered a top fighting master in his previous life, but now, a female high school student practicing karate can show strength far beyond him.

Sure enough, something is wrong with this world...

At this moment, Lin Xinyi finally realized the reality clearly:

At first, he thought he had traveled to Japan in the past, but now it seems that this is not the world he was originally in at all.

The original earth was about science, and Sir Newton would not be mad to death every day.

But this earth now is obviously a low-level world with supernatural powers.

He suddenly jumped from the "Urban Life" channel to the "Urban Superpowers" channel.

"Is there a different world where 'Superman' exists..."

Lin Xinyi suddenly became very interested in this world with sudden changes in painting style.

Like all teenagers, he had actually fantasized about the martial arts life of high and low.

Moreover, although it sounds like he is boasting, he is indeed a once-in-a-century martial arts prodigy.

Lin Xinyi was born in a martial arts family.

Under the influence of his family environment, he exercised at the age of five, learned boxing at the age of six, and read through family martial arts at the age of seven.

When he was eight years old, he performed martial arts in front of his elders during the Chinese New Year. The elders of his clan praised him:

"If I had been born three or four hundred years earlier, I could have been a founding master."

The elder was worried that such a martial arts prodigy would be delayed by the impetuous world of entertainment, so he encouraged him to practice martial arts quietly and exercise self-restraint. On this grounds, he gave him 100 yuan less new year's money.

The original lucky money was only 100 in total.

At the age of nine, Lin Xinyi participated in a karate interest class.

After studying for a month, the coach refunded three times the tuition fee and sent him away crying:

"Don't come here anymore, it's not like this."

After learning about this, Lin's father took Lin Xinyi to participate in various fighting training classes many times and never tired of it.

Back then, when the names of Lin and his son were mentioned, all the gym coaches in the city changed their expressions.

At the age of ten, Lin Xinyi competed with two Tibetan mastiffs who lost control of their ropes and competed with one against two.

In the end, at the cost of 400 yuan for rabies vaccine and seven stitches on the legs, he beat the two mastiffs until they bowed their heads like dogs.

At the age of eleven, Lin Xinyi spent all his time practicing various fighting techniques, forgetting food and sleep, and his martial arts improved further.

Seeing how selfless he was, his mother couldn't help but sigh:

"Are you still spending your time here?"

"You will be promoted from primary school to junior high school in two years. Do you know what your test scores are now?"

Twelve years old, studying hard.

At the age of thirteen, he was studying hard, but unexpectedly had a conflict with a gangster outside school.

Lin Xinyi fought one against ten, injuring 6 people, scaring 3 people away, and scaring 1 person to the urine.

In the same year, the local public security agency successfully solved a mass fight case that had a negative social impact, and in accordance with the criminal law, the 13-year-old person involved in the case, Lin, was severely criticized and educated.

...

Lin Xinyi's martial arts career ended like this.

And he also truly understood that being a knight would not work in the real world.

A chivalrous person uses force to break the law. If you want to be a chivalrous person, you must learn the true ability of justice.

Therefore, Lin Xinyi chose to become a police officer.

But his mother was afraid that a fighting master like him would be sent to take on dangerous tasks when he became a police officer, so she firmly opposed it.

Finally, after some compromise, Lin Xinyi chose to become a forensic doctor.

Forensic doctors are also criminal police officers, but they do technical work, which is very safe.

However, despite the heavy study work, Lin Xinyi did not give up his efforts.

The exercise continued and my skills did not weaken.

Even, because I have learned forensic knowledge and memorized the "Human Injury Identification Standards"...

He has broken through to the terrifying level where he can beat people to the point of death, but his peers can only identify minor injuries.

A master is still a master, but he no longer has the obsession with martial arts he had when he was a teenager.

But now, Lin Xinyi has regained his enthusiasm as a martial arts practitioner.

"Since a female high school student can become so powerful by practicing karate..."

"Then as long as I practice hard in this world, I will definitely be able to break through the limits of human beings."

Lin Xinyi couldn't help but feel a little excited.

At the same time, he also had a bold idea:

"And if this world is not scientific at all..."
